DAC meeting on PCPNDT Act held at Kishtwar
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sappTelegram

KISHTWAR, MARCH 18: District Advisory Committee (DAC) meeting on the Pre-Conception and Pre-Natal Diagnostic Techniques (PCPNDT) Act was today held under the Chairmanship of Chief Medical Officer Kishtwar Dr. Rajinder Kumar.

The meeting focused on reviewing the Act’s implementation across the district, with detailed discussions on the registration of ultrasound centres, as well as the provisions for offences, penalties, and the overall monitoring mechanism.

CMO provided an update on the district’s eight ultrasound clinics, comprising six private centres and two government-run facilities. He also gave a detailed account of the block-wise latest Child Sex Ratio data, which stands at 968 girls per 1000 male children.

The CMO emphasized the crucial role of the PCPNDT Act in promoting a healthy girl-child sex ratio and directed strict enforcement through random inspections of ultrasound clinics.

The meeting was attended by DAC members including DIO Kishtwar Dr Kuldeep Kumar, Dr Shabnam Laila, Dr. Javed Iqbal Giri other senior doctors, representatives of NGOs, owners of private ultrasound clinics and other officials.
